Remarks
Trace from a Vertex Crossing. NB: the direction vector is defined on the surface, not the tangent plane. This means, it must lie in a triangle adjacent to Direction.EdgeID Trace Result.
Parameters
| Name | Description |
|---|---|
| VID | Vertex ID (per the FDynamicMesh3) where the trace starts |
| Direction | Surface direction of trace. |
| MaxDistance | Maximal distance this trace can travel. |
